Abstract
Rare earth oxyhalides, e.g. DyOCl and TbOCl, which are easily termed in the purification process for rare earth raw materials and chemically stable compared to DyCl3 or TbCl3, have been reduced by CaH2 under a heated conditions, and the resultant Dy or Tb metal has been introduced to the inside of Nd-Fe-B magnet pieces. The Dy or Tb metal modified magnets showed the higher coersivity without any reduction of the remanence values than the untreated magnets.
